Exploring the Different Zip Codes

Zip Code 80302

As mentioned earlier, zip code 80302 is home to the Pearl Street Mall, one of Boulder’s most popular destinations. This pedestrian-friendly outdoor mall features a wide variety of shops, restaurants, and street performers. Visitors can also check out the Boulder Museum of Contemporary Art or catch a show at the historic Boulder Theater.

Exploring the Local Culture

Boulder is known for its vibrant arts and culture scene. Visitors can check out the Boulder Museum of Contemporary Art or head to the Dairy Arts Center for live theater and music performances. For those interested in history, the Boulder History Museum is a great option, while the Fiske Planetarium offers a unique educational experience.

Exploring the Outdoors

Boulder is a nature lover’s paradise, with plenty of opportunities for hiking, biking, and other outdoor activities. Visitors can head to the Flatirons for a challenging hike or check out the Boulder Creek Path for a leisurely bike ride. For something more off the beaten path, consider a visit to the Boulder Mountain Park or the South Boulder Creek Trail.

Question and Answer

Q: What is the best time of year to visit Boulder?

A: The best time to visit Boulder depends on what you’re looking for. Summer is a popular time for outdoor activities, but fall offers stunning foliage and fewer crowds. Winter is perfect for skiing and snowboarding, while spring offers milder weather and wildflowers.

Q: What is the best way to get around Boulder?

A: Boulder is a very walkable city, and many attractions are within walking distance of each other. Biking is also a popular option, and the city has an extensive bike path network. Additionally, there is a local bus system, and ride-sharing services like Uber and Lyft are widely available.

Q: What are some must-visit restaurants in Boulder?

A: Boulder is known for its farm-to-table cuisine and innovative dining scene. Some popular options include The Kitchen, Oak at Fourteenth, and Frasca Food and Wine. For something more casual, head to The Buff for breakfast or Snarf’s for a sandwich.

Q: What are some family-friendly activities in Boulder?

A: Families with kids will love the Children’s Museum of Boulder or the Butterfly Pavilion. Additionally, the Boulder Reservoir is a great spot for swimming and boating, while the Boulder Creek Path is perfect for a family bike ride.
